'Apprentice' Winner Weds 'E!'s News' Host

Bill Rancic, Giuliana DePandi say 'I do' in Italian and English

"The Apprentice" winner Bill Rancic, who first applied to be on "The Bachelor," isn't one anymore.

The reality show star and his fiancee, "E! News" anchor Giuliana DePandi, tied the knot in Italy this past weekend, reports People

The traditional Catholic ceremony was held on the island of Capri on Saturday, Sept. 1. The wedding was conducted in both Italian and English.

DePandi, 32, wore a white, strapless and beaded Monique Lhuillier gown, while Rancic, 36, wore a black tux. Performing maid of honor duties was DePandi's sister Monica, and Rancic's "honorary" best man was his late father.

Rancic's boss, Donald Trump, could not attend the wedding due to scheduling conflicts.

The couple first met when DePandi interviewed him as the first season's "Apprentice" winner, but it wasn't until February 2006 when she interviewed him again and discovered that he was still single. Behind the scenes, Rancic asked her out on their first date. The pair became engaged in December after Rancic pulled off an elaborate proposal that involved a helipad, deep-dish pizza, rose petals and champagne.

Rancic has been with the Trump Organization since his first-season win and appears frequently on the show to advise the Donald. He's the author of two books, "You're Hired" and "Beyond the Lemonade Stand."

DePandi is an anchor for "E! News Live" and often co-hosts red carpet events with Ryan Seacrest. She also wrote a book, "Think Like a Guy: How to Get a Guy by Thinking Like One."

The newlyweds will hold off on the honeymoon for now due to the demands of their respective jobs. DePandi will cover the Emmys on Sept. 16, while Rancic will host IVillage's "In the Loop."
